10 Things to Know Before Hiring a Personal Injury Lawyer in Perth
If you’ve been injured due to someone else’s negligence, choosing the right personal injury lawyer is one of the most important decisions you’ll make. The legal professional you select can significantly influence the outcome of your claim, the compensation you receive, and the overall experience you have navigating the legal process.
Whether you’re dealing with a motor vehicle accident, workplace injury, public liability incident, or medical negligence claim, here are 10 essential things to know before hiring a personal injury lawyer Perth.
Not All Lawyers Specialise in Personal Injury Law
Personal injury law is highly specialised. Before engaging a lawyer, make sure they practise primarily—or exclusively—in personal injury matters. Specialists are more familiar with insurers, negotiation tactics, legislation, and court procedures relevant to compensation claims.
Experience Matters More Than You Think
Ask how long the lawyer has been practising personal injury law and whether they’ve handled cases similar to yours. A seasoned lawyer will know how to build strong evidence, negotiate confidently, and anticipate the other side’s strategies. Experience can often mean a faster, more effective resolution.
Understand Their Fee Structure (Especially No Win, No Fee)
Many personal injury lawyers in Perth operate on a “No Win, No Fee” basis, but the fine print varies. Some firms still charge disbursements upfront, while others cover them until settlement. Ask:
- What exactly is included under “No Win, No Fee”?
- Do you pay if the case is unsuccessful?
- What percentage or amount will be deducted from your settlement?
Transparency here is crucial.
Communication Style Matters
You’ll likely be dealing with your lawyer over several months or even years. Make sure their communication style works for you. Do they explain things clearly? Are they responsive? Do you feel comfortable asking questions? Good communication is a sign of professionalism and client care.
They Should Offer a Free Initial Consultation
Reputable personal injury lawyers usually provide a free first consultation. This is your chance to evaluate whether the lawyer is knowledgeable, approachable, and genuinely interested in your case. Don’t be afraid to consult more than one firm before making a decision.
Ask About Their Success Rate
While lawyers can’t guarantee outcomes, they can provide insight into their track record. A lawyer who consistently achieves favourable settlements or verdicts is more likely to secure a strong result for you.
Understand the Likely Timeline
Personal injury claims vary widely in duration. Some settle within months; others take years if they proceed to court. Your lawyer should be able to give you a rough timeframe based on the complexity of your case and the steps involved.
Courtroom Experience Is a Plus
Most compensation claims settle without going to trial. However, hiring a lawyer with litigation experience can strengthen your position. Insurers take negotiations more seriously when they know the opposing lawyer is prepared to go to court.
You Should Know the Potential Value of Your Claim
A knowledgeable lawyer will explain the types of compensation you may be entitled to, which can include:
- Medical expenses
- Lost income
- Pain and suffering
- Rehabilitation costs
- Future economic loss
Understanding the potential value helps you make informed decisions throughout your claim.
Trust Your Instincts
Finally, your lawyer should make you feel confident and supported. If something feels off—rushed consultations, vague answers, or poor communication—consider looking elsewhere. Trust is essential in any legal relationship.
